Output 588fabc8a79605594cbc3a01abc09ac3b5a228b1a77e9bfc003981870366d1bc:45

value
38880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21439a6eb708d5cbf8ca6d172f9681b7fd8f4aea OP_EQUAL
address
34iuD2ifndBm8GcFpDojE9EdC1ZEgEzgf2
transaction
588fabc8a79605594cbc3a01abc09ac3b5a228b1a77e9bfc003981870366d1bc
spent
true